What Is a Private Pay Psychiatrist?
A private pay psychiatrist is a mental health expert who supplies psychiatric services without operating through insurance strategies. This means that clients pay out-of-pocket for their consultations and treatments. This design can enable for higher flexibility in regards to scheduling and treatment options and typically results in longer visits compared to those covered by insurance.
Advantages of Choosing a Private Pay Psychiatrist
Longer Sessions: Many private pay psychiatrists provide longer visit times, allowing for comprehensive examinations and more in-depth discussions.

Minimized Administrative Burden: Without the requirement to expense insurance companies, private pay practices tend to have less red tape, which can streamline the visit process.

Tailored Treatments: Psychiatrists working beyond insurance constraints have more liberty to establish customized treatment plans that cater to specific client needs.

Improved Privacy: Private pay services often maintain a higher degree of confidentiality, as there is no requirement to share patient details with insurance provider.

Flexible Scheduling: Many private pay psychiatrists offer higher versatility in scheduling, accommodating last-minute visits and varying hours.
Considerations When Searching for a Private Pay Psychiatrist
When looking for a private pay psychiatrist, a number of aspects enter play. Here are some essential requirements to think about:

Specialization: Psychiatrists can focus on numerous locations, including mood disorders, Anxiety Treatment UK disorders, PTSD, and more. Ensure that the psychiatrist has experience dealing with the specific condition you are facing.

Area: Proximity matters. Look for psychiatrists available near your home or workplace to help with simple access.

Credibility: Research online evaluations and seek recommendations from good friends, household, or doctor to determine trustworthy professionals.

Availability: Verify the psychiatrist's accessibility to guarantee they can accommodate your schedule for regular sees.

Cost: While private pay psychiatrists do not take insurance, the cost of services can differ substantially, so it's crucial to go over costs upfront.

Method to Treatment: Different psychiatrists may use varying treatment techniques (medication management, psychiatric therapy, holistic techniques). Discovering one that lines up with your preferences is essential.
Actions to Find a Private Pay Psychiatrist Near You
Research study Online: Use keyword searches like "private pay psychiatrist near me" or "out-of-pocket psychiatrist" to assemble a list of possible service providers.

Speak with Directories: Resources such as Psychology Today, Zocdoc, or the American Psychiatric Association's directory site can assist find experts near your place.

Network: Reach out to good friends, family, or healthcare experts for suggestions. Individual experiences can assist you towards credible specialists.

Set Up Consultations: Many psychiatrists provide initial consultations-- often at a lower charge-- to determine if it's an excellent fit. Make the most of this to ask concerns and assess compatibility.

Evaluate Fit: After assessments, review whether you felt comfortable and comprehended throughout the visit. The relationship you construct with your psychiatrist is essential.

What is the distinction between a psychiatrist and a psychologist?A psychiatrist is a medical doctor who can identify and treat mental health conditions, typically using medication as part of their treatment technique, while a psychologist has a doctoral degree in psychology and usually supplies treatment without recommending medication.2. Can I still utilize insurance for therapy sessions if I see a private pay psychiatrist?Yes, some insurance coverage companies may reimburse you for sessions with a private pay psychiatrist, but you ought to examine your particular policy and standards to understand how this process works.3. Are there sliding scale payment alternatives for private pay psychiatrists?Some psychiatrists use sliding scale charges based on income, making services more budget friendly for clients.
